Abstract

Initial observations indicate that the cognitive ability of mathematics in the material of number patterns is relatively low and students' collaboration skills have not been seen. So the purpose of this study is to produce a valid, practical, and effective project-based dakon-assisted teaching module; in order to determine students' cognitive abilities and collaboration skills. In its learning, this study raises the culture of traditional Javanese games, namely Dakon. The method used in this study is the Research and Development (R&D) method with the ADDIE model. Data were obtained using pre-test-post-test instruments, LKPD, collaboration skills assessment questionnaires, and practicality questionnaires for teaching modules. The results of the study showed that: (1) The validity results of the teaching module reached 3.68 (very valid); pre-test-post-test validation of 3.73 (very valid); LKPD validation of 3.55 (valid); questionnaire validation of 3.70 (very valid) so that the teaching module and its instruments are said to be suitable for use in learning; (2) The results of the practicality questionnaire for the teaching module reached 87% score, so the application of the teaching module is said to be very practical. In addition, the teaching module has been tested on small groups and large groups of 24 students; (3) the N-Gain results obtained were 82%, which means that the application of the teaching module in the implementation of large group tests is said to be effective in improving students' cognitive abilities; (4) Furthermore, the results of collaboration skills obtained from the questionnaire data obtained a figure of 3.70 (very effective) which means that the teaching module is said to be very effective in improving students' collaboration skills.
